We will be updating our written workplace safety/covid prevention plan and continue to follow the Los Angeles County Department of Public Health “K-12 Schools Reopening Protocols” (aka “Appendix T1”) which is anticipated around June 15th, along with the Final CalOSHA determination . . . which the News Outlets are now saying will align with the CA STATE Dept of Public Health’s upcoming June 15th guidelines.

The Los Angeles County Department of Public Health “Schools Exposure Management Plan” (aka “Appendix T2”) covers testing requirements surrounding OUTBREAKS specifically. Currently, Athletics ASIDE and outside of an outbreak, the CA state nor LA DPH does NOT presently Mandate SURVEILLANCE testing nor at any particular cadence. With conditions improving/protocols loosening, it’s hard to imagine they would ADD a SURVEILLANCE Testing Requirement.

What is determined for general industry workplaces could be different for what SCHOOLS, healthcare or congregate settings are required to do. And as Ms. Jammee said, a lot can change between now and 7/31…and even after that.
